|
Datamine répond à plusieurs objectifs :
- Afficher une arborescence de BDD plus complète que dans SSMS, par exemple les informations suivantes sont directement fournies dans l'arborescence :
- Nombre de lignes dans les tables
- Nombre de colonnes pour les tables, les vues, etc.
- Taille des lignes
- Dépendances pour chaque objet
- Interface basée sur des fenêtres libres
- Simplification de la consultation des données d'une table : une table peut être ouverte dans une fenêtre QBE, des filtres peuvent être ajoutées, des fenêtres de données peuvent être ouvertes pour des tables liées avec un rafraichissement automatique selon la ligne affichée dans la fenêtre de départ
- Simplifier la recherche dans les informations de structure : il est par exemple possible de rechercher un nom de colonne pour savoir dans quelles tables, vues, déclencheurs, procédures stockées, etc. est utilisée cette colonne
- Automatiser la recherche d'anomalies en exécutant une batterie de tests pour savoir ce qui ne va pas ou doit alerter sur une base de données (exemples : éléments non vérifiés, index couverts par d'autres index)
- Permettre de consulter facilement tous les objets de la base de données avec toutes leurs caractéristiques (exemples : liste des tables avec la place occupée, liste des index avec leurs taux de fragmentation, liste des procédures stockées avec leur code source, etc.)
|
|
Datamine meets several objectives:
- Display a more complete database tree than in SSMS, for example the following informations are provided directly in the tree:
- Number of rows in tables
- Number of columns for tables, views, etc.
- Rows size
- Dependencies for each object
- Interface based on free windows
- Simplification of table data consultation: a table can be opened in a QBE window, filters can be added, data windows can be opened for linked tables with automatic refresh according to the line displayed in the first window
- Simplify the search in structure information: it is for example possible to search for a column name to know in which tables, views, triggers, stored procedures, etc. is used this column
- Automate the search for anomalies by running a battery of tests to find out what is wrong or should alert on a database (examples: unverified elements, indexes covered by other indexes)
- Allow easy consultation of all database objects with all their characteristics (examples: list of tables with the space occupied, list of indexes with their fragmentation rates, list of stored procedures with their source code, etc.)
|